Mahin is a professional contemporary & hip-hop choreographer from Princeton, NJ. He started his dance journey learning the Indian classical dance art of Bharatanatyam. In 2018, he accomplished his Arangatram receiving a B.A. (Visharad) degree in Bharatanatyam. He later traveled to Gujarat, India to receive his M.A. (Alankar) degree in Bharatanatyam from the Tanjor Institute of Arts. While studying Indian classical dance, Mahin also attended Broadway Dance Center’s Children & Teen Program to round out his dance training in Western styles of dance (e.g., Ballet, Jazz, Hip-Hop, Contemporary, Modern). There, he was a part of their audition-based dance company AIM (Artists in Motion). During his college studies in Boston, he learned from and participated in Boston’s Hip-Hop dance community, directing several dance teams, choreographing for teams and companies, and creating dance projects. He’s worked professionally as a choreographer for many years, through simple gigs. He now continues to choreograph contemporary and hip-hop pieces that are influenced by his unique background. Mahin aims to leverage his passion for creating art through movement by telling conceptual and important stories. His choreographic style is influenced by the several dance styles and techniques he has studied throughout his dance journey and aims to have a distinctive interpretation of musicality/texture.
